What is a Health and Safety Audit?

A health and safety audit is a process that ensures compliance with current health and safety regulations, as outlined in the Occupational Health and Safety Act 85 of 1993. While its purpose is to ensure compliance, it also assesses how well you’re following processes and your overall performance. 

Why are Health and Safety Audits Important? 

Health and safety audits are crucial because they proactively identify workplace hazards, ensure compliance with regulations (Occupational Health and Safety Act 85 of 1993), and promote a safer, healthier environment for employees, ultimately reducing accidents, injuries, and associated costs.

Compliance Certificate:  

A Health and Safety Compliance Certificate is issued upon completing a Workplace Health and Safety Compliance Audit. This certification indicates that the organisation meets the necessary health and safety standards.
